Spinal decompression describes a healing technique focused on minimizing stress on the spinal discs and bordering structures. This approach includes the application of controlled traction to the spine, which helps to produce space between the vertebrae. By doing so, it can ease nerve compression and advertise far better spinal positioning.Spinal decompression can be performed utilizing numerous techniques, including mechanical gadgets, hand-operated control, or specialized tables made to help with the procedure - Spinal Decompression. The strategy aims to recover the natural curvature of the spine while enhancing circulation to the affected locations, which might add to healing
Clients seeking spinal decompression frequently experience symptoms such as neck and back pain, sciatica, or herniated discs. This technique is normally considered a non-invasive choice for those discovering alternatives to surgery or medicine. Understanding the auto mechanics and goals of spinal decompression is essential for assessing its relevance as a restorative technique.

Techniques of Spinal Decompression
Decompression treatment includes various techniques designed to eliminate stress on the spine and promote healing. One usual strategy is spinal decompression therapy, which uses a motorized grip table to delicately stretch the spine. This technique intends to develop negative stress within the discs, facilitating the retraction of bulging or herniated discs.Another method is hands-on spinal decompression, where skilled specialists apply hands-on techniques to manually change the spine and ease stress. Chiropractic adjustments additionally function as a form of spinal decompression, employing details adjustments to recover proper placement.

Who Can Profit From Spinal Decompression?
Who can really gain from spinal decompression therapy? This treatment is specifically advantageous for individuals dealing with persistent back discomfort, herniated discs, sciatic nerve pain, and degenerative disc disease - Family Chiropractic. Clients experiencing nerve compression, which can result in tingling or weak point in the limbs, may likewise discover relief through this non-surgical intervention. Additionally, those who have actually not responded well to conventional discomfort monitoring strategies or physical therapy frequently turn to spinal decompression as a sensible alternative. People looking for to boost their overall spinal health and boost flexibility can benefit from this treatment, as it intends to alleviate pressure on the vertebrae and spinal discs. It is essential, nonetheless, for potential candidates to seek advice from healthcare experts to figure out if spinal decompression is appropriate for their details conditions and needs. The length of time Does a Normal Spinal Decompression Session Last?
A common spinal decompression session normally lasts between 30 to 45 mins. Patients frequently go through numerous sessions over several weeks, depending upon their particular condition and therapy plan developed by their doctor.Are There Any Negative Effects of Spinal Decompression Therapy?
Spinal decompression therapy might result in moderate side effects, such as temporary soreness, muscular tissue convulsions, or discomfort. Nevertheless, major problems are rare, and the majority of individuals experience alleviation from symptoms after treatment.Can Spinal Decompression Be Executed at Home?
Spinal decompression can be done at home using specialized tools or techniques, such as inversion tables or stretching workouts. Consulting a healthcare specialist prior to trying home treatment is recommended to ensure security and effectiveness.Just How Lots Of Sessions Are Usually Required for Reliable Outcomes?
Typically, individuals call for in between 15 to 30 sessions of spinal decompression treatment for reliable outcomes. The specific number may vary based upon individual conditions, therapy objectives, and the intensity of back issues experienced.What Qualifications Should a Professional Have for Spinal Decompression?
